The exhibit, Crazy Quilt Mania, examines the above trends through the exhibition of 23 crazy quilts selected from the Kentucky Museum collection. In addition to crazy quilts, this exhibit includes examples of textile and non-textile fancywork as well as numerous fancywork illustrations and advertisements from the period.

Every April about 30,000 quilters from around the world descend on Paducah (population 25,000) for the American Quilter’s Society QuiltWeek. Clearly for lots of people, quilting rocks. Paducah’s museum is the biggest facility in the world devoted to the art of quilting, and though from the outside it’s an ...Specialties: Our Art Museum in-facility and touring exhibits are annually viewed by over 115,000 quilt and art enthusiasts. The museum is a global destination welcoming visitors from all 50 US states and over 40 foreign countries on a yearly basis. Visitors experience three galleries of extraordinary quilt and fiber art rotated 7-8 times per year so there is always something new to see. The ...

The Kentucky Museum at WKU has opened a new exhibit, Stitches in Time: 200 Years of Kentucky Quilts, showcasing thirty of the finest quilts in its collection. Stitches in Time includes traditional and art quilts ranging in age from the early 19th century to the early 21st century.
